8 Factors Affecting Window Installation Time 🛠️
Several factors can influence how long it takes to install a window in your home. Below, we’ll go over 8 of these key factors.
1. Window Type
The type of window you’re installing, such as a standard double-hung window or a more complex bay window, can significantly impact the installation time.
2. Window Size
Larger windows generally require more time for installation due to their weight and size.
3. Window Material
Different materials, such as wood, vinyl, or aluminum, can affect installation time. Some materials may require additional steps or precautions.
4. Condition of Existing Frame
If the existing window frame is in good condition, it may expedite the installation process. However, repairs or adjustments to the frame can add time.
5. Preparation Work
Any necessary prep work, such as removing old windows, framing adjustments, or addressing structural issues, will add to the overall timeline.
6. Number of Windows
The more windows you’re replacing, the longer the project will take.
7. Weather Conditions
Inclement weather can slow down the installation process, as it may not be safe or feasible to work in adverse conditions.
8. Installer Experience
The skill and experience of the installation crew can impact efficiency and speed.
Typical Window Installation Timeline ⏰
While the exact timeline for window installation can vary depending on the factors mentioned above, here’s a general breakdown of the typical process:
1. Preparation (1-2 hours):
- Remove window coverings and clear the area around the window.
- Disconnect any alarms or security systems connected to the window.
- Ensure the work area is clean and accessible for the installation crew.
2. Removal of Old Window (1-3 hours):
- Carefully remove the existing window, taking care not to damage the surrounding wall or frame.
- Inspect the frame for any damage or rot and address it as needed.
3. Installation of New Window (2-4 hours per window):
- Properly fit and secure the new window into the opening.
- Apply sealant or insulation to create an airtight and watertight seal.
- Ensure the window operates smoothly and locks securely.
4. Trim and Finish Work (2-4 hours):
- Install interior and exterior trim to cover gaps and create a finished appearance.
- Apply caulk or sealant around the window to prevent drafts and moisture infiltration.
- Paint or stain the trim to match your home’s aesthetic.
5. Clean-up and Final Inspection (1-2 hours):
- Remove debris and clean the work area, both inside and outside your home.
- Conduct a final inspection to ensure the window is properly installed and functions correctly.
6. Quality Check and Testing (1-2 hours):
- Test the window’s operation, including opening, closing, and locking.
- Check for any air or water leaks.
- Verify that the window meets safety and building code requirements.
7. Final Touches (1-2 hours):
- Install window coverings, blinds, or curtains, if desired.
- Reconnect any alarms or security systems.
8. Post-Installation Walkthrough (30 minutes – 1 hour):
- The installation crew should provide you with a walkthrough of the installed window, explaining its features and maintenance requirements.
A Note on Multi-Window Installations 🪟🪟🪟
If you’re replacing multiple windows in your home, you can expect the window replacement installation process to be more efficient in terms of time per window. This is because certain steps, such as preparation and clean-up, can be streamlined when working on multiple windows in the same area.
How to Speed Up Window Installation 🚀
While the installation timeline can vary, there are steps you can take to expedite the process:
- Choose the Right Window Type: Opt for window types that are easier and quicker to install, such as standard double-hung windows.
- Prep the Work Area: Ensure the installation crew has easy access to the windows and that the area is clear of obstacles.
- Clear Your Schedule: Plan the installation on a day when you can be available in case the installers have questions or need access to certain areas of your home.
- Communicate Clearly: Discuss your expectations with the professional window installation crew upfront, including any specific requirements or preferences.
